Present Perfect HWK

Download as pdf or txt
Download as pdf or txt
You are on page 1of 10

Unit

15 I have done (present perfect 1)


j cleaned my sh oee^

His shoes are dirty. He has cleaned his shoes.


(= his shoes are clean now)

They are at home. They are going out. They have gone out.
(= they are not at home now)

has cleaned / have gone etc. is the present perfect (have + past participle):
I cleaned I cleaned?
we have ('ve) finished have we
we finished?
finished? [ regular verbs
have
you have not (haven't) started you started?
they lost they lost?
he done he
he done? I irregular
has ('s) been hac been? verbs
she has she \
has not (hasn't) gone gone?
it it

past participle

Regular verbs The past participle is -ed (the same as the past simple):

clean —> I have cleaned finish —» we have finished start —>she has started

Irregular verbs The past participle is not -ed.


Sometimes the past simple and past participle are the same:

buy —> I bought / 1have bought have —> he had / he has had

Sometimes the past simple and past participle are different:

break —> I broke / 1have broken see -» you saw / you have seen
fall —> it fell / it has fallen go —> they went / they have gone

We use the present perfect for an action in the past with a result now:
O I've lost my passport. (= I can't find my passport now)
O 'Where's Rebecca?' 'She's gone to bed.' (= she is in bed now)
O We've bought a new car. (= we have a new car now)
O It's Rachel's birthday tomorrow and I haven't bought her a present. (= I don't have a present
for her now)
O 'Bob is away on holiday.' 'Oh, where has he gone?' (= where is he now?)
O Can I take this newspaper? Have you finished with it? (= do you need it now?)

present perfect Units 16-19 present perfect and past simple Unit 20
irregular verbs Unit 24, Appendix 2-3______________________________________
Exercises
f O Look at the pictures. What has happened? Choose from the box.

go to bed c lean his shoes stop raining


close the door fall down have a shower

—> M They.

Hi 1 M M He.

—> The.

H g | Complete the sentences with a verb from the box.

break buy decide finish forget go go


invite lose see not/see take tell not/tell

1 I y e jo s t my keys. I don't know where they are.


2 I ........................................................................some new shoes. Do you want to see them?
3 'Where is Helen?' 'She's not here. S h e ...................................................................... out.'
4 I'm looking for Paula...................................y o u ................................................. her?
5 Look! Som ebody........................................................................that window.
6 'Does Lisa know that you're going away?' 'Yes, I ........................................................................ her.'
7 I can't find my umbrella. Som ebody........................................................................it.
8 'Where are my glasses?' 'I don't know. I ...................................................................... them.'
9 I'm looking for Sarah. W h e re ...............................sh e ..................................................?
10 I know that woman, but I ........................................................................ her name.
11 Sue is having a party tonight. S h e a lot of people.
12 W hat are you going to do? ............................... y o u ..................................................?
13 a: Does Ben know about the meeting tomorrow?
B: I don't think so. I ........................................................................him.
14 I with this magazine. Do you want it?
I've ju st... I’ve already...
16 I haven't... yet (present perfect 2)
I've j u s t ...

ju s t = a short time ago


O a: Are Laura and Paul here?
b: Yes, they've j u s t arrived.

O a: Are you hungry?


b: N o, I've j u s t had dinner.

O a : Is Tom here?
b: N o, I'm afraid he's j u s t gone. % mk
(= he h a s just gone)
They have just arrived.

I've alre a d y ...

already = before you expected / before I expected Yes, I know. We’ve


already met.
O a: W hat time are Laura and Paul coming?
b: They've already arrived.
(= before you expected)

O It's only 9 o'clock and Anna has already


gone to bed. (= before I expected)

O a: Jon, this is Emma.


b: Yes, I know. We've already met.

I h aven 't... yet / Have you ... yet?

yet = until now


We use yet in negative sentences and questions. Yet is usually at the end.

yet in negative sentences (I haven't... yet)


O a: Are Laura and Paul here?
b. No, they haven't arrived yet.
(but B expects Laura and Paul to arrive soon)

O a: Does James know that you're going away?


b: N o, I haven't told him yet.
(but B is going to tell him soon)
The film hasn't started yet.
O Silvia has bought a new dress, but she hasn't worn it yet.

yet in questions (Have you ... yet?)


O a: Have Laura and Paul arrived yet?
b: N o, not yet. We're still waiting for them.

O a: Has Nicola started her new job yet?


b: N o, she starts next week.

O a: This is my new dress.


b: Oh, it's nice. Have you worn it yet?

42 ( present perfect Units 15,17-20 word order 4 Unit 94 still, yet and already 4 Unit 95 )
Exercises
Write a sentence with just for each picture.

1 Theyyeju s t arrived 3 T h e y ......


2 H e ............................................ 4 The race

Complete the sentences. Use already + present perfect.

| g g } Write a sentence with just (They've ju s t ... / She's ju s t ... etc.) or a negative sentence with yet
(They haven't... yet / She h asn't... yet etc.).

CD a fe w minutes now {2} a few minutes now o/ew minutes


go uM< ago
(OUT
« . r

• * H lV -
(she / go / out) (the bus / go) (the train / leave)
Sha hasn’t.gpne out yet... The b u s............

© o/ew minutes now | GD o/ew minutes now © o/ew minutes


ago ago ago

(they / finish / their dinner) (it / stop / raining) u

Write questions with yet.


1 Your friend has a new job. Perhaps she has started it. You ask her:
Have you s.ta.rtad.your naw .......... .....................................................................
2 Your friend has some new neighbours. Perhaps he has met them. You ask him:
....................... y o u ..................................................................................................................................................
3 Your friend has to pay her electricity bill. Perhaps she has paid it. You ask her:

4 Tom was trying to sell his car. Perhaps he has sold it. You ask a friend about Tom:
Unit
17 Have you ever... ? (present perfect 3)
Have you been
to Rome? Yes, I have.
Many times.

Have you ever


been to Japan? No, I've never
been to Japan.

We use the present perfect (have been / have had / have played etc.) when we talk about a time from
the past until now - for example, a persons life:

Have you ever been to Japan?

— time from the past until now -


past now

O 'Have you been to France?' 'No, I haven't.'


O I've been to Canada, but I haven't been to the United States.
O Mary is an interesting person. She has had many different jobs and has lived in many places.
O I've seen that woman before, but I can't remember where.
O How many times has Brazil won the W orld Cup?
O 'Have you read this book?' 'Yes, I've read it twice.' (twice = two times)

present perfect + ever (in questions) and never:

O 'Has Ann ever been to Australia?' 'Yes, once.' (once = one time)
O 'Have you ever played golf?' 'Yes, I play a lot.'
O My sister has never travelled by plane.
O I've never ridden a horse.
O 'W ho is that man?' 'I don't know. I've never seen him before.'

gone and been

two weeks later

, Ben. ^

Hi. I've been


on holiday. I've
been to Spain.
BEN

Ben has gone to Spain. Ben has been to Spain.


(= he is in Spain now) (= he went to Spain, but now he is back)

Compare:
O I can't find Susan. Where has she gone? (= where is she now?)
O Oh, hello Susan! I was looking for you. Where have you been?

44 ( present perfect 4 Units 15-16,18 present perfect and past simple 4 Unit 20
Exercises
You are asking Helen questions beginning Have you e v e r... ? Write the questions.

Helen

1 (be / London?) Have you ever ^ No, never.


2 (play/golf?) Have you.ever played j o l f ? ........... Yes, many times.
3 (be / Australia?) H ave.................................................................. Yes, once.
4 (lose / your passport?) No, never.
5 (fly / in a helicopter?) Yes, a few times.
6 (win / a race?) No, never.
7 (be / New York?) Yes, twice.
8 (drive / a bus?) No, never.
9 (break / your leg?) Yes, once.

Write sentences about Helen. (Look at her answers in Exercise 17.1.)


1 (be / New York) S t e 's bean, to Naw York tw ice ........................................
2 (be / Australia) S h e ...........................................................................................................
3 (win / a race) ........................................................................................................................
4 (fly / in a helicopter) ........................................................................................................

Now write about yourself. How often have you done these things?
5 (be / New York) I ...........................................................................................................
6 (play / tennis) ...................................................................................................................
7 (drive / a lorry) ................................................................................................................
8 (be / late for work or school) .................................................................................

Mary is 65 years old. She has had an interesting life. What has she done?
Jvum
11aVv be all over the world a lot of interesting things
do write many different jobs a lot of interesting people
travel meet ten books married three times
Mary

1 Sh e has. had. m anydifferentj'pbs..


2 She...................................................................
3 ..................................................................................
4 ...........................................................................
5 .....................................................................
6 ........................................................................

| Write gone or been.


1 Ben is on holiday at the moment. He's gone to Spain.
2 'Have you e ve r..................................... to Mexico?' 'No, never.'
3 M y parents aren't at home at the moment. They've ..................................... out.
4 There's a new restaurant in town. Have y o u ........................................ to it?
5 Rebecca loves Paris. She's........................................ there many times.
6 Helen was here earlier, but I think she's.........................................now.
7 'Where's Jessica?' 'She's not in the office. I think she's.........................................home.'
8 Hello, Sue. I was looking for you. Where have y o u .......................................?

-> Additional exercises 16,18 (pages 258-60)


Unit
19 for since ago
for and since

We use for and since to say how long:

for three days,


Helen is in Ireland. She has been there
since Monday.

We use for + a period of time We use since + the start of the period
(three days / two years etc.): (Monday / 9 o'clock etc.):

start of the
period

for three days


Monday since Monday

past now past now

for since

three days ten minutes Monday Wednesday


an hour two hours 9 o'clock 12.30
a week four weeks 24 July Christmas
a month six months January I was ten years old
five years a long time 1985 we arrived

O Richard has been in Canada for six O Richard has been in Canada since
months. (not since six months) January. (= from January to now)

We've been waiting for two hours. O We've been waiting since 9 o'clock.
(not since two hours) (= from 9 o'clock to now)

O I've lived in London for a long time. O I've lived in London since I was ten
years old.

ago

ago = before now:


O Susan started her new job three weeks ago.(= three weeks before now)
O 'W hen did Tom go out?' Ten minutes ago.' (=ten minutes before now)
O I had dinner an hour ago.
O Life was very different a hundred years ago.
We use ago with the past (started/did/had/was etc.).

Compare ago and for:


O When did Helen arrive in Ireland?
She arrived in Ireland three days ago.

O How long has she been in Ireland?


She has been in Ireland for three days.

SitlllSfl

48 ( present perfect + for/since -> Unit 18 from/until/since/for ^ Unit 104 for and during^ Unit 105 )
Exercises
| Write for or since.
1 Helen has been in Ireland sin ce Monday.
2 Helen has been in Ireland fo r three days.
3 M y aunt has lived in A ustralia................................ 15 years.
4 Tina is in her office. She has been there ............................... 7 o'clock.
5 India has been an independent co u n try...............................1947.
6 The bus is late. We've been w aiting...............................20 minutes.
7 Nobody lives in those houses. They have been e m p ty.................................many years.
8 Michael has been ill................................ a long time. He has been in hospital.................................October.

Answer these questions. Use ago.


1 When was your last meal? T h rcc.h cu rs ago...............................................................
2 When was the last time you were ill?.....................................................................................................................................
3 W hen did you last go to the cinema?....................................................................................................................................
4 W hen was the last time you were in a car? ..........................................................................................................
5 W hen was the last time you went on holiday? ..........................................................................................................

Com plete the sentences. Use for or ago w ith these words.
i ^
1 Helen arrived in Ireland Thraa d a y s ago............................................................................................ (three days)
2 Helen has been in Ireland f o r th re e d a y s......................................................................................... (three days)
3 Lynn and Mark have been m arried........................................................................................................... (20 years)
4 Lynn and Mark got m arried........................................................................................................................... (20 years)
5 Dan arrived.............................................................................................................................................................. (anhour)
6 I bought these shoes.......................................................................................................................................... (a few days)
7 Silvia has been learning English.................................................................................................................... (sixmonths)
8 Have you known Lisa........................................................................................................................................ ? (a long time)

Com plete the sentences w ith for or since.


1 (Helen is in Ireland - she arrived there three days ago)
Hejen has boon j.n.lrcland.fo^ ........................................... ............................ L ............
2 (Jack is here - he arrived on Tuesday)
Jack h as............................................................................................................................................................................................................
3 (It's raining - it started an hour ago)
It's b een...........................................................................................................................................................................................................
4 (I know Sue - I first met her in 2008)
I've............................................................................................................................................................... ......................................................
5 (Claire and M att are married - they got married six months ago)
Claire and M att have..............................................................................................................................................................................
6 (Laura is studying medicine at university - she started threeyears ago)
Laura h as.................................................................................................................................................’......................................................
7 (David plays the piano - he started when he was sevenyears old)
David h a s........................................................................................................................................................................................................

c m W rite sentences about yourself. Begin your sentences w ith:

I've lived ... I've been ... I've been learn ing... I've known ... I've had ...

1 IVeJivcdjn t h is town .fp .rth re e^ aars. ...............................


2 ...................
3 ...............................................................................................................................................................................................................................
4 ...............................................................................................................................................................................................................................
5 ...........................................................................................................................................................................................................................................................

-*• Additional exercises 16-18 (pages 258-60)


Key to Exercises

12.3 13.4 UNIT 16


2 I got up before 7 o'clock, or 2 He was carrying a bag.
16.1
I didn't get up before 3 He wasn't going to the dentist.
2 He's/He has just got up.
7 o'clock. 4 He was eating an ice cream.
3 They've/They have just
3 I had a shower, or I didn't 5 He wasn't carrying an umbrella.
bought a car.
have a shower. 6 He wasn't going home.
4 The race has just started.
4 I bought a magazine, or I 7 He was wearing a hat.
didn't buy a magazine. 8 He wasn't riding a bicycle. 16.2
5 I ate meat, or I didn't eat 2 they've/they have already
meat. UNIT 14 seen it.
6 I went to bed before 10.30. 14.1 3 l've/l have already phoned
or I didn't go to bed before 1 happened ... was painting ... him.
10.30. fell 4 He's/He has already gone
2 arrived ... g o t... were waiting (away).
12.4
3 was walking ... m e t ... was 5 l've/l have already read it.
2 did you arrive
going ... was carrying ... 6 She's/She has already started
3 Did you win
4 did you go stopped (it).
5 did it cost 14.2 16.3
6 Did you go to bed late 2 was studying 2 The bus has just gone.
7 Did you have a nice time 3 Did Paul c a ll... called ... was 3 The train hasn't left yet.
8 did it happen / did that having 4 He hasn't opened it yet.
happen 4 didn't go 5 They've/They have just
5 were you driving ... stopped finished their dinner.
12.5
... wasn't driving 6 It's / It has just stopped
2 bought 6 didn't have
6 Did your team win ... didn't raining.
3 Did it rain 7 did you do
4 didn't stay 8 didn't know play 16.4
5 opened 7 did you break ... were playing 2 Have you met your new
... k ick e d ... hit neighbours yet?
UNIT 13 8 Did you see ... was wearing 3 Have you paid your electricity
13.1 9 were you doing bill yet?
2 Jack and Kate were at the 10 lo s t... did you g e t... climbed 4 Has Tom/he sold his car yet?
cinema. They were watching UNIT 17
UNIT 15
a film.
3 Tom was in his car. He was 15.1 17.1
driving. 2 She has/She's closed the door. 3 Have you ever been to
4 Tracey was at the station. She 3 They have/They've gone to Australia?
was waiting for a train. bed. 4 Have you ever lost your
5 M r and Mrs Hall were in the 4 It has/it's stopped raining. passport?
park. They were walking. 5 He has/He's had a shower. 5 Have you ever flown in a
6 (Example answer) I was in 6 The picture has fallen down. helicopter?
a cafe. I was having a drink 15.2 6 Have you ever won a race?
with some friends. 2 've bought / have bought 7 Have you ever been to New
3 's gone / has gone York?
13.2
4 Have you seen 8 Have you ever driven a bus?
2 she was playing tennis
5 has broken 9 Have you ever broken your
3 she was reading a/the
6 Ve told / have told leg?
paper/newspaper
4 she was cooking (lunch) 7 has taken
5 she was having breakfast 8 haven't seen
6 she was cleaning the kitchen 9 has she gone
10 've forgotten / have forgotten
13.3
11 's invited / has invited
2 W hat were you doing
12 Have you decided
3 Was it raining
13 haven't told
4 W hy was Sue driving
14 've finished / have finished
5 Was Tom wearing

286
Key to Exercises

17.2 18.3 19.5


Helen: 2 She has lived in Wales all her Example answers
2 She's/She has been to life. 2 I've been in the same job for
Australia once. 3 They have been on holiday ten years.
3 She's/She has never won a since Sunday. 3 I've been learning English for
race. 4 The sun has been shining all six months.
4 She's/She has flown in a day. 4 I've known Chris for a long
helicopter a few times. 5 She has been waiting for ten time.
You (example answers): minutes. 5 I've had a headache since I
5 I've/I have never been to 6 He has had a beard since he got up this morning.
New York. was 20.
UNIT 20
6 I've/I have played tennis 18.4
many times. 2 I know 20.1
7 I've/I have never driven a lorry. 3 I've known 2 I started (it)
8 I've/I have been late for work 4 have you been waiting 3 they arrived
a few times. 5 works 4 she went (away)
17.3 6 She has been reading 5 I wore it
2-6 7 have you lived 20.2
She's/She has done a lot of 8 I've had 3 I finished
interesting things. 9 is ... He has been 4 OK
She's/She has travelled all over 5 did you finish
UNIT 19
the world, or She's/She has 6 OK
been all over the world. 19.1 7 (Steve's grandmother) died
She's/She has been married 3 for 6 for 8 Where were you / Where did
three times. 4 since 7 for you go
She's/She has written ten books. 5 since 8 for ...since 20.3
She's/She has met a lot of 19.2 3 played
interesting people. 4 did you go
Example answers:
17.4 2 A year ago. 5 Have you ever met
2 been 6 gone 3 A few weeks ago. 6 wasn't
3 gone 7 gone 4 Two hours ago. 7 's/has visited
4 been 8 been 5 Six months ago. 8 switched
5 been 9 lived
19.3
3 for 20 years 10 haven't been
UNIT 18
4 20 years ago 20.4
18.1 5 an hour ago 1 Did you have ... was
3 have been 6 a few days ago 2 Have you seen ... w e n t...
4 has been 7 for six months haven't seen
5 have lived / have been living 8 for a long time 3 has worked / has been
6 has worked / has been working working ... w a s... worked ...
19.4
7 has had didn't enjoy
2 Jack has been here since
8 have been learning 4 've/have seen . . . 've/have
Tuesday.
18.2 3 It's been raining for an hour. never spoken ... Have you
2 How long have they been 4 I've known Sue since 2008. ever spoken ... met
there? or ... been in Brazil? 5 Claire and Matt have been
3 How long have you known married for six months.
her? or ...kno w n Amy? 6 Laura has been studying
4 How long has she been medicine (at university) for
learning Italian? three years.
5 How long has he lived in 7 David has played / David has
Canada? / How long has he been playing the piano since
been living... ? he was seven years old.
6 How long have you been a
teacher?
7 How long has it been raining?

287

You might also like